Keep your aging Mac from going obsolete past installing a patched version of macOS Mojave.

Delight do note that if yous install any Mojave update from Apple on your Mac you will "brick" your machine and you will be required to practice erase your HDD/SSHD/SSD and starting time over. '''

  1. Grab a copy of the Mojave Patch Tool at the link below:

    • Take hold of a copy of the Mojave Patch Tool at the link below:

    • http://dosdude1.com/mojave/

    • Brand certain that your Mac is compatible (in "Requirements") before you starting time.

    • You will need a wink drive that is at to the lowest degree 16 GB in size and a re-create of the patch tool in lodge to do this process.

  2. Once the patch tool has finished downloading, open it the .dmg file and wait for it to mount. Inside the .dmg file, you will see an application named macOS Mojave Patcher. Double click it to open the application. If you get the error message "macOS Mojave Patcher can't be opened because it's from an unidentified developer.",(2nd image) you can bypass this by right clicking the application and clicking open (3rd image).

  3. Now, we will format the USB drive so it can  be used by the patch tool. Insert your 16 GB or higher USB drive into your Mac. Open Disk Utility

    • Open Disk Utility

    • Type "disk utility" into spotlight search and it should testify up.

    • Erase the USB Drive and format it into macOS Extended (Journaled) format. The name of the drive does not matter.

  4. If your Mac is not supported by this patch tool the patch tool will let you know that your machine does not support the Mojave patch. If that error is shown, it's the end of the road for your Mac. :-( Go back to the patch tool window and go the the menu bar These following steps are only necessary if you do not have a copy of the Mojave installer application.

    • Click "Tools" and so click "Download macOS Mojave" in the dropdown menu when it appears.

    • Click continue, and and then select where you will save the installer.

    • I saved the installer to my desktop. Relieve it to wherever you lot want, only recall where y'all saved it.

  5. Once the Mojave installer has finished downloading, select the Mojave icon in the macOS Mojave Patcher window.

    • Select your Mojave installer and click open

    • Now, select your book by clicking the dropdown menu nether the flick of a hard drive. You lot desire to select the proper name of your USB drive.

    • My USB drive is not Macintosh HD. Do non select your Mac'due south hard drive/solid state drive/solid state hybrid drive. Instead, select your USB bulldoze's name.

    • Click get-go performance. This may take a while to consummate based on your bulldoze speed.

  6. Once this process has been completed, eject your USB drive and shut down your Mac.

    • Press the power push on your Mac and hold down the option central on the keyboard equally soon as you lot either encounter the grey startup screen or the bong.

    • If you only take a windows keyboard holding down the "ALT" cardinal has the same effect as holding the option central.

    • Proceed property the choice key down until you run across a screen that looks similar to the picture I attached.

  7. Use the arrow keys to move the outlined box over to the yellow box with the USB logo on it. Press enter when you have highlighted that box.

  8. Only perform steps 8 and 9 if you intend to do a clean install. Otherwise, you can simply skip these steps and install to your volume containg a previous version of OS X, and it'll do an in-place upgrade.

    • Open disk utility past going to utilities in the menu bar and clicking disk utility.

  9. Click on your HDD/SSHD/SSD in the sidebar menu and click erase at the top of the window.

    • Select Mac Os Extended (Journaled) or APFS and name your HDD/SSHD/SSD to whatsoever name yous would similar it to have.

    • The format APFS is required in Mojave to become the usual software system updates. If y'all prefer to select Mac Bone Extended (Journaled), you lot won't get any system updates.

    • APFS volition work on the Terminate 2009 models and later on every bit with High Sierra. If your device doesn't back up originally High Sierra (and therefore isn't able do first with APFS) , you won't accept any recovery partitions and the reboot display will be different.

    • Once y'all have successfully erased your drive, click the words "disk utility" in the menubar. Click close and Disk Utility should shut.

  10. Click continue at this menu

  11. Click your HDD/SSHD/SSD that you want Mojave to be installed onto. Click continue after selecting your drive.

  12. Sit back and relax while Mojave is being installed onto your Mac.

    • Pro tip: If you would similar to encounter what is going on behind the scenes of the installer window y'all can press Command + L to run into the installer log.

  13. Once the installer is done installing, shut down your computer.

    • Follow footstep 6 again to reboot onto your Mojave installer bulldoze.

    • This time, instead of installing Mojave once more we need to install the necessary patches for Mojave to run properly.

    • Click macOS Post Install in either the side menu or from the dropdown bill of fare in utilities.

  14. Select your type of Mac in the dropdown menu.

    • The patch tool automatically detects your Mac model and shows what you have here. If you are unsure at all which Mac you lot accept, select the model listed hither.

    • My suggestion is that you select ALL of the checkboxes that you can. Information technology does not injure to practise so and it can exist helpful later on on. Most of the checkboxes are necessary for Mojave to run properly anyways.

    • Non all of the checkboxes volition exist selected at starting time. Be sure to select all of them.

    • Choose the bulldoze for the patches (the i where you only installed Mojave). Click patch later doing all of the necessary things higher up.

  15. Click reboot after all of the patches are completed.

    • The patch as well might rebuild the cache later pressing reboot, so be patient and wait for your Mac to reboot on its own.

  16. You should now have been rebooted into a fully working copy of Mojave. Yay you!

    • If the reboot is not successful, start the patch tool again to reinstall the patches and select the box "Force Enshroud Rebuild" before the reboot.
